Buildings across the Scottish Borders will be among those participating in a captivating Doors Open Days this year

Celebrating its 35 year, Doors Open Days is a national event that provides free access to sites and activities throughout Scotland, promoting awareness of the country’s built and cultural heritage and ensuring it is accessible to all.

Events in the Scottish Borders will be taking place across 7 and 8 September and allow the region to showcase the places for which it is known for including some lesser-known hidden gems.

What to look forward to

Scottish Borders events taking place include:

  • Free guided tours of Borders Distillery
  • The chance to explore Channelkirk Church
  • See behind the scenes at TD9 Radio, where visitors will see live programmes being broadcast and have a look around the studios
  • Walks around the largest Roman fort site north of Hadrian’s Wall - Trimontium Fort
